    The Role of Vitamin D in Infancy

    Vitamin D is essential for calcium and phosphorus absorption, which are critical for bone mineralization and growth. In infants, adequate vitamin D levels support the development of strong bones and may influence immune system maturation and function.

    Sources of Vitamin D

    1. Sunlight Exposure: Ultraviolet B (UVB) radiation from sunlight induces vitamin D synthesis in the skin. However, factors such as geographic location, skin pigmentation, seasonal changes, and the use of sunscreen can significantly reduce cutaneous production.

    2. Dietary Intake: Vitamin D is naturally present in few foods, such as fatty fish (e.g., salmon, mackerel) and egg yolks. Fortified foods, like certain cereals and dairy products, contribute to dietary intake but are not typically consumed in sufficient quantities by infants.

    3. Supplementation: Given the limitations of sunlight and diet, vitamin D drops offer a reliable method to ensure adequate intake during infancy.

    Breastfeeding and Vitamin D

    Breast milk is the optimal source of nutrition for infants but contains minimal amounts of vitamin D (approximately 25 IU per liter). The American Academy of Pediatrics (AAP) recommends that all breastfed and partially breastfed infants receive a daily supplement of 400 IU of vitamin D starting within the first few days of life. This recommendation accounts for the low vitamin D content in breast milk and aims to prevent deficiency and associated complications.

    Formula Feeding Considerations

    Infant formulas in the United States are fortified with vitamin D at concentrations of 400 IU per liter. Infants consuming at least 1 liter (approximately 33.8 ounces) of formula daily receive adequate vitamin D without additional supplementation. However, infants consuming less than this amount may require supplemental vitamin D drops to meet the recommended intake.

    Risk Factors for Vitamin D Deficiency

    1. Limited Sun Exposure: Infants with minimal sunlight exposure due to high latitudes, seasonal changes, or cultural practices (e.g., extensive clothing coverage) are at increased risk.

    2. Darker Skin Pigmentation: Increased melanin reduces the skin's ability to produce vitamin D from sunlight, necessitating higher exposure times.

    3. Maternal Deficiency: Vitamin D status during pregnancy influences neonatal stores. Mothers with vitamin D deficiency may have infants with low vitamin D levels at birth.

    4. Preterm Infants: Premature infants have reduced vitamin D stores and increased nutritional needs, often requiring individualized supplementation strategies.

    Health Implications of Vitamin D Deficiency

    1. Rickets: Characterized by impaired bone mineralization, rickets leads to bone deformities and growth disturbances. Despite being preventable, rickets remains a concern in certain populations due to vitamin D deficiency.

    2. Immune Function: Vitamin D modulates innate and adaptive immune responses. Deficiency may predispose infants to increased susceptibility to infections and autoimmune conditions.

    3. Long-term Health Outcomes: Emerging research suggests that early-life vitamin D status may influence the risk of chronic diseases later in life, including asthma, type 1 diabetes, and certain allergic conditions.

    Recommendations from Health Organizations

    · American Academy of Pediatrics (AAP): Recommends 400 IU/day of vitamin D for all infants, starting shortly after birth.

    · World Health Organization (WHO): Emphasizes the importance of adequate maternal vitamin D levels during pregnancy and lactation but does not universally recommend supplementation for infants in regions with sufficient sunlight exposure.

    · Institute of Medicine (IOM): Aligns with the 400 IU/day recommendation for infants up to 12 months of age.

    Administration of Vitamin D Drops

    Vitamin D drops are available in various formulations. It is essential to:

    1. Choose Appropriate Products: Ensure the supplement provides the recommended dosage without exceeding safe upper limits.

    2. Educate Caregivers: Provide instructions on accurate dosing to prevent under- or overdosing.

    3. Monitor Compliance: Assess adherence during routine visits and address any barriers to supplementation.

    Risks of Excessive Vitamin D Intake

    While rare, vitamin D toxicity can occur, leading to hypercalcemia and associated complications such as nephrocalcinosis. It is crucial to avoid excessive supplementation and consider all sources of vitamin D intake when advising caregivers.

    Clinical Considerations and Special Populations

    1. Maternal Supplementation: High-dose maternal vitamin D supplementation during lactation may improve breast milk vitamin D content, potentially reducing the need for infant supplementation. However, this approach requires further research and careful monitoring.

    2. Cultural Practices: Be mindful of cultural beliefs and practices that may influence acceptance of supplementation. Provide culturally sensitive education to promote adherence.

    3. Monitoring Vitamin D Status: Routine screening of vitamin D levels in infants is not generally recommended but may be warranted in high-risk populations or if deficiency is suspected.
